AI-generated summary. Hog Says

In June 2014, Start Bay recorded 714 wave observations across 31 observed days, with coverage listed as 103% of the 30-day calendar period. Average wave height was 1.4 ft, ranging from 0.3 to 5.6 ft, while wave periods averaged 7.6 seconds and ranged from 2 to 29 seconds. Water temperature averaged 14.9°C, with 713 observations, and no wind values were recorded.

About Start Bay wave buoy

Start Bay is a Datawell Directional WaveRider station off the south Devon coast. First deployed in April 2007, it measures waves entering the bay between Start Point and the Dartmouth approaches. Available observations include wave height, period and direction, sea temperature and calculated wave power.
